What is the best way to get around Negombo?

The best way to get around Negombo is by tuk-tuks. They are cheap, easy to find anywhere in the city, and perfect for short trips around the resort.

A tuk-tuk ride in the city will cost from 300 rupees. For example, from the tourist area of Lewis Place to the bus station or railway stationβ€”that's exactly how much it costs. There are three main ways to use a tuk-tuk:

  • Catch one on the streetβ€”there are dozens everywhere, but always agree on the price BEFORE the ride and bargain
  • Order through an appβ€”Uber and PickMe have the option to order a tuk-tuk at a fixed price
  • Rent for a whole dayβ€”costs from 5000 rupees for trips to attractions

Negombo is a small city, and it's quite possible to get around on foot, especially if you're staying in the tourist area. But be careful: there are few sidewalks, and where they existβ€”they are often occupied by parking or trade.

City buses are practically useless for getting around Negombo itselfβ€”they mainly run on the outskirts and between districts.
